Abstract
A single-stage low temperature catalytic process for desulphurisation of a gas which contains a mixture of H.sub.2 S and SO.sub.2 which process includes feeding the gas to be treated at a temperature below the dew point of sulphur to a Claus converter having a Claus catalyst in a reaction stage in which the catalyst includes a composite catalytic mass of alumina and one or more compounds of titanium, yttrium, lanthanum or the rare-earth elements of atomic number 58 to 71, and contacting the gas with the Claus catalyst at a temperature below the dew point of sulphur, by which sulphur deposits on the Claus catalyst and the gas is desulphurised.
